What is the impact of using moving averages in cryptocurrency trading?
How does the use of moving averages affect cryptocurrency trading strategies and outcomes?
3 answers
- Strickland CaseJan 02, 2022 · 4 years agoUsing moving averages in cryptocurrency trading can have a significant impact on trading strategies and outcomes. Moving averages are commonly used as technical indicators to identify trends and potential entry or exit points in the market. By calculating the average price over a specific period of time, moving averages smooth out price fluctuations and provide traders with a clearer picture of the overall trend. This can help traders make more informed decisions and reduce the impact of short-term price volatility. Additionally, moving averages can be used to generate trading signals, such as when a shorter-term moving average crosses above or below a longer-term moving average, indicating a potential trend reversal. However, it's important to note that moving averages are lagging indicators and may not always accurately predict future price movements. Traders should use moving averages in conjunction with other technical analysis tools and consider other factors, such as market conditions and news events, when making trading decisions.

- SeusanSep 07, 2025 · 9 months agoUsing moving averages in cryptocurrency trading can have a significant impact on trading strategies and outcomes. Moving averages are commonly used by traders to identify trends and potential entry or exit points in the market. For example, a trader may use a combination of a shorter-term moving average, such as the 20-day moving average, and a longer-term moving average, such as the 50-day moving average, to generate trading signals. When the shorter-term moving average crosses above the longer-term moving average, it may indicate a potential trend reversal and a buying opportunity. Conversely, when the shorter-term moving average crosses below the longer-term moving average, it may indicate a potential trend reversal and a selling opportunity. By using moving averages, traders can filter out short-term price fluctuations and focus on the overall trend, which can help improve trading accuracy and profitability. However, it's important to note that moving averages are lagging indicators and may not always accurately predict future price movements. Traders should use moving averages in conjunction with other technical analysis tools and consider other factors, such as market conditions and news events, when making trading decisions.
